Tools

iSniff-GPS

I've only tested the script with TP-Link TL-WN722N. It has to be hardware version 1.10. The current hardware version 2 and 3 doesn't work.

To install run:

./bin/setup-iSniff-GPS.sh

To use it run:

./bin/iSniff-GPS-listen.sh      # Start to listen
./bin/iSniff-GPS-web.sh         # Start web server and iceweasel

Alfa wireless card

I have a wireless card from Alfa. To get it working do the following after connecting with USB 3.0 if run in Fusion:

sudo apt-get install realtek-rtl88xxau-dkms
sudo modprobe 88XXau

To activate it in monitoring mode run:

sudo ip link set wlan0 down
sudo iwconfig wlan0 mode monitor
sudo ip link set wlan0 up

More information can be found in this blog about How to get your new 5 GHz wireless penetration gear up and working.

howmanypeoplearearound

How Count the number of people around you by monitoring Wi-Fi signals with the help of howmanypeoplearearound.

cd ~/kali-tools/bin
./configure-alfa-monitor.sh
./install-howmanypeoplearearound.sh
cd ~/src/howmanypeoplearearound && . venv/bin/activate && howmanypeoplearearound -a wlan0

To create a graph of run the following command in one window:

cd ~/src/howmanypeoplearearound && . venv/bin/activate && howmanypeoplearearound -o test.json -a wlan0 --loop

After a couple of points been created run this command in another window:

cd ~/src/howmanypeoplearearound && . venv/bin/activate && howmanypeoplearearound --analyze test.json
